From wild escarpments and ancient rainforest to manicured manor gardens and rolling vineyards, this mountain region offers diverse landscapes to explore and enjoy.

The Southern Highlands encompasses the rolling and mountainous hinterland southwest of Sydney and has wonderful national parks and gardens. Check out the area’s natural marvels, including bushland lookouts, waterfalls and ancient forests. After a day in the outdoors, settle in with a glass of regional cool-climate wine and a breathtaking mountain vista.

Explore the Southern Highlands’ charming townships, including Bowral, Bundanoon, Berrima, Mittagong and Moss Vale. Wander the towns’ historic streets and stop by boutique restaurants to savour regional produce and award-winning local wines. The region’s wellness spas offer relaxing treatments in gorgeous natural settings. In Bowral, discover a cherished piece of national history at the Bradman Museum and International Cricket Hall of Fame, which celebrates the lives of well-known Australian cricketers and the inimitable career of former Bowral local Sir Donald Bradman.

Follow the Southern Highlands’ walking trails and be rewarded with stunning views across the region’s peaks and tablelands. Find a range of walks for different fitness levels at the Morton National Park, the Mount Jellore Lookout, the Bowral Lookout, Gibbergunyah Reserve or the trail to the renowned cascade of Fitzroy Falls, which plunges through a fragrant rainforest gully. Enjoy unbeatable views of temperate rainforest and mountain ranges across the Illawarra, the Southern Highlands and Budderoo National Park from the Illawarra Fly Treetop Walk in Robertson.

Stay at Southern Highlands’ distinguished manor houses, such as Peppers Craigieburn, Berida Manor and Peppers Manor House. Stroll through the historic estates to admire manicured gardens and rustic architecture. The Corbett Gardens in Bowral is famous for its spring Tulip Time festival.

The Southern Highlands is located midway between Sydney and Canberra, within Australia’s magnificent Great Dividing Range. Reach the region within a 1-hour drive of the South Coast. Stay in historic country towns, upscale manors or beautiful forest retreats in this relaxing natural hideaway. The Southern Highlands has a cool climate with low humidity. Enjoy gorgeous native blooms in late winter or check out pretty English-style gardens in spring.
